Thirsk, a market town set between the dales and moors of North Yorkshire in the beautiful Vale of Mowbray, is the inspiration for James Herriot’s Darrowby, and the World of James Herriot museum is a hugely popular family attraction. Thirsk is also famous for its 15th century church and its racecourse.
Holidays in Thirsk –Stunning countryside in the Vale of Mowbray
The Vales of York and Mowbray not only boast some of the most breathtaking scenery in Yorkshire, but important archaeological sites, and Marston Moor and Stamford Bridge, sites of the famous battles of the civil war and King Harold’s defeat of the Viking forces. There are many historic buildings to visit within the area; stay at a country lodge and enjoy complete freedom to plan your days out sightseeing at sites such as Fountains Abbey, Yorkshire’s first World Heritage site. The site of the ruins of a Cistercian abbey, Fountains comprises 10 historic buildings, as well as an open air theatre and the famous Studley Royal water garden. Also close to Thirsk you’ll find Rievaulx Abbey, Castle Howard, Shandy Hall and Ripon Cathedral – or visit York Minster, the Viking Centre, Ripley Castle and gardens at Harrogate, or its Turkish Baths and Health Spa.
Thirsk Holidays – Family holidays and activities in North Yorkshire
The Thirsk area offers a spectacular selection of family days out; visit Big Sheep and Little Cow Farm, a petting farm, or Monk Park Farm Visitor Centre, where you’ll see a host of farm animals plus wallabies, alpaca and llamas. Lightwater Valley Theme Park boasts England’s longest rollercoaster and many other thrilling rides, and Flamingo Land offers rides and play areas and the zoo, with lions, chimpanzees, meerkats and much more. There are Bird of Prey centres locally and some unique exciting experiences, such as ghost walks in York and the Floatation Tank Experience in Harrogate. The Montpellier Quarter in Harrogate offers an exciting shopping experience with art galleries, antique shops, designer clothes and jewellery, cafes and restaurants, all in a traditional atmosphere.
